Bar Manager

Salary: Starting at £13.84 per hour

Hours: 40 hours per week (Flexible rota including evenings, weekends, and bank holidays) 

About the Role

Are you a hospitality professional with a passion for the great outdoors? Park Cliffe Camping & Caravan Park  is looking for an experienced and enthusiastic Bar Manager to take the helm at our stunning site in the heart of the Lake District.

In this role, you aren’t just managing a bar; you are creating a high-quality, welcoming environment for our guests as they enjoy their leisure time. You will lead a small team of Bar Assistants, ensuring the facility operates safely, profitably, and to an exceptional standard of service.

Key Responsibilities

  • Team Leadership: Recruit, coach, and manage the performance of Bar Assistants, including scheduling rotas and administering weekly payroll.
  • Operational Excellence: Take full ownership of cellar management (line cleaning, keg rotation, gas safety) and maintain a premium environment for guests.
  • Financial Performance: Manage stock levels, conduct regular stocktakes, and work within budgets to achieve profit targets.
  • Commercial Strategy: Identify opportunities for upselling and refresh our drinks menu to reflect current trends and local tastes.
  • Safety & Compliance: Ensure all operations strictly adhere to the Licensing Act (Challenge 25), COSHH, and Food Hygiene regulations.

What We’re Looking For

  • Experience: 2–3 years in a bar supervisory or management role within a hospitality environment. Experience in a seasonal holiday park environment is highly desirable.
  • Technical Skill: Strong knowledge of cellar management and draught systems is essential.
  • Licensing: You must be a Personal Licence Holder (or be willing to obtain your APLH).
  • Leadership: A proven ability to motivate a small team and resolve conflicts effectively.
  • Flexibility: As this is a seasonal environment, you must be able to work a flexible rota, including peak holiday periods, evenings, and bank holidays.
  • Logistics: This is not a live-in position. Candidates should ideally live within 20–30 minutes of the site and have reliable transportation.

Bar Assistant

We are seeking two enthusiastic and reliable Bar Assistants to join our team at our award-winning park overlooking Lake Windermere. If you enjoy a fast-paced environment and take pride in delivering a warm, “Lake District” welcome to guests, we want to hear from you.

Details:

  • Hours: 30 hours per week, working five days out of seven.
  • Shifts: Afternoon and evening shifts, including weekends.
  • Closing: Shifts include the bar close at 22:00 and subsequent clean-down.
  • Start Date: As soon as possible.
  • Contract End Date: 2nd January 2027
  • Rate of Pay: £13.25 per hour

You will be the face of our bar service, handling everything from serving local drinks and managing the till to ensuring our high hygiene standards are met. We are looking for team players who genuinely enjoy interacting with holidaymakers in a beautiful setting.

Purpose of Job:

To provide a friendly, professional, and efficient service to our guests while maintaining high standards of hygiene and cleanliness in line with Site guidelines. This role encompasses both bar and table service duties.

Key Tasks & Accountabilities:

  • Guest Experience: Maintain a welcoming, approachable, and helpful attitude at all times to ensure excellent customer service is delivered to every guest.
  • Operational Excellence: Competently operate the electronic till and handle transactions following established Site procedures.
  • Sales & Stock Management: Maintain stock levels and attractive displays to maximise sales potential. Actively promote products and services to help increase Site revenue.
  • Health, Safety & Hygiene: Ensure all bar and service areas are kept clean and tidy. Follow safe manual handling procedures and adhere to all Hygiene and Health & Safety regulations, including Natasha’s Law.
  • Risk Management: Actively identify and report potential hazards or near misses to the line manager, ensuring appropriate action is taken in accordance with Site procedures.
  • Professional Standards: Maintain a high standard of personal presentation and uniform. Ensure that all food and drink products are presented to the guest in line with Site standards.
  • Performance Support: Assist the department in meeting internal targets, including revenue goals, hygiene audit results, and stock-take accuracy.
  • Teamwork & Flexibility: Maintain constructive working relationships with colleagues across the site. Be prepared to undertake reasonable additional tasks to ensure the smooth running of the site.
  • Feedback: Share guest and team feedback with management to suggest improvements for service or revenue growth.

Experience:

  • Previous experience working in a bar or hospitality environment is an advantage but not essential.
